Understanding new media -- The political economy of new media -- Politics and citizenship -- Divides, participation and inequality -- New media uses and abuses -- Security, surveillance and safety -- New media and journalism -- Mobile media and everyday life -- New media and identity -- Socialities and social media -- Games and gaming -- The future of new media.
Gives students the tools and the knowledge they need to make sense of the relationship between technologies, media and society.
